Deep Dive

1. Eroding Core Utility (Bearish Impact)

Overview: WINkLink's foundational purpose was severely undermined in 2025 when TRON DAO adopted Chainlink Data Feeds as its primary oracle (CoinMarketCap). This move discontinued WIN's main utility within the ecosystem it was built for. While the project announces upgrades and AI integrations, it must now compete for relevance without its original home-field advantage.

What this means: The loss of privileged status within TRON removes a key driver for organic, utility-based demand for WIN tokens. Future price appreciation now heavily depends on the project successfully carving out a new, competitive niche—a significant challenge that creates a persistent overhang on its valuation.

2. Market Position & Adoption (Mixed Impact)

Overview: WIN exists in a crowded oracle sector dominated by Chainlink. Its potential now hinges on securing partnerships and integration in emerging areas like RWAs and NFTs on TRON. A recent positive catalyst was its listing on Bit2Me alongside other TRON tokens in March 2026, which improved accessibility (Bit2Me).

What this means: New exchange listings can provide short-term liquidity and attention. For a sustained bullish impact, however, metrics like the number of integrated dApps and volume of data requests must grow significantly to prove the network's utility beyond its legacy status.

3. On-Chain & Social Momentum (Neutral Impact)

Overview: Social activity shows a dedicated community, with the team regularly posting market updates. On-chain data from January 2026 indicated a notable spike, with transfers increasing 140% and volume reaching $9.2M (Defi_Zee). However, the current Fear & Greed Index of 40 ("Neutral") suggests broader crypto sentiment isn't providing a strong tailwind.

What this means: Sporadic spikes in on-chain activity can lead to short-term price rallies, but without corresponding growth in fundamental utility, these may prove unsustainable. Traders should watch for consistent increases in active addresses and network use, not just one-off events.
